The Mechanics of Hair Weaving: Understanding the Basics
To master hair weaving techniques, it's crucial to comprehend the fundamental mechanics involved. Hair weaving refers to the process of attaching natural or synthetic hair to existing hair using various methods, such as hand-tied or machine-made extensions. The technique involves sectioning the client's hair, securing it with clips or ties, and then weaving the new hair into the existing hair strand by strand.
There are several types of hair weaving techniques, including:
- Hand-tied extensions: A time-consuming yet precise method, ideal for fine hair.
- Machine-made extensions: A quicker and more affordable option, suitable for thicker hair.
- Micro-link extensions: A popular choice for thin hair, offering a natural, undetectable look.
Debunking Common Myths and Misconceptions
One common misconception surrounding hair weaving is that it's a painful process. In reality, modern techniques and high-quality materials have minimized discomfort and made the experience more comfortable for clients. Furthermore, hair weaving is not just for special occasions; it's a versatile hairstyle solution suitable for everyday life.
Another myth is that hair weaving requires an extensive amount of maintenance. While it's true that hair weaving requires regular upkeep to prevent matting and tangling, modern technologies and tools have made it easier than ever to maintain a beautiful, healthy-looking updo.
